This position serves as a Spanish Language Court Interpreter in the courtroom, assisting interested parties as deemed necessary by the presiding judge in Baltimore City Circuit Court. Provides oral interpretation and sight translation for spoken communication and court-related documents.
Sedentary work; may require lifting up to 10 pounds occasionally or negligible force frequently; walking and standing only occasionally.
Personal computer, copier, scanner, interpreter equipment.
Microsoft Office; data entry; personal computer usage to enter and review information.
This is an At‑Will position and serves at the pleasure of the Maryland Judiciary and assigned court location(s). Parking is included for this position.
